BNEF forecasts that global energy storage additions will reach 92 GW or 247 GWh in 2025, excluding pumped hydro. This marks a 23 percent increase in gigawatts over 2024, reflecting robust growth across established and emerging markets. BMS ¬† (Battery Management System) is any electronic system that manages a rechargeable battery (cell or battery pack), such as by monitoring its state, calculating secondary data, reporting it, protecting the battery, controlling its environment, and balancing it. The average cost for sodium-ion cells in 2024 is $87 per kilowatt-hour (kWh), slightly cheaper than Lithium-ion cells at $89/kWh. Assuming similar capital expenditures, sodium-ion batteries will likely reach around $10/kWh by 2028, making them more affordable than Lithium-ion. . CATL's announced sodium-ion battery pricing of $19 per kilowatt hour represents a 65% reduction from current lithium iron phosphate costs of $55-$70/kWh, not the 90% cost decline claimed across social media channels promoting the technology. You are allowed to have 40 kWh in the utility closet, 80 kWh in a detached garage, 80 kWh in either a detached structure, and 80 kWh mounted on its own pad. This means the theoretical maximum limit you can install on a one or two-family property is 280 kWh. . If batteries are being installed inside a home, they must be protected by a utility closet, which must have a minimum of 5/8″ gypsum board on the walls and ceiling. You can install a maximum of 40 kWh worth of batteries. . These systems can be paralleled up to 14 units if a larger battery storage system is required.
